THE 3-MINUTE DEMI LASH METHOD

Start with clean, dry lashes. If you have any leftover mascara from yesterday, that’s your problem. Demi lashes need a blank canvas to grip onto. Take the demi lash out of the tray and hold it up to your eye. It shouldn’t extend past your outer corner. If it does, trim the outer end — never the inner corner. That keeps the natural lift pointing outward.

  1. Tilt your head back slightly. Look down into a mirror.
  2. Apply a thin line of adhesive along the lash band. Wait 30 seconds until tacky.
  3. Press the center of the lash band onto your lash line first. Then press the inner and outer corners down.
  4. Use your fingers to gently squeeze your natural lashes together with the demi lash. Hold for 10 seconds.

WHAT TO LOOK FOR IN A DEMI LASH (BEFORE ANY BRAND)

If you’re shopping for demi lashes, don’t get distracted by fancy names. Look for these three things:

  • Band thickness: thin bands flex and blend. If the band is thick or shiny, it will look like an eyeliner stripe.
  • Lash fiber stiffness: soft, matte fibers look like hair. Stiff, shiny fibers look plastic.
  • Length variety: demi lashes should come in different lengths per lash. If every lash is the same length, you’re getting a strip lash that will look like a brush.

HOW TO REMOVE AND REUSE DEMI LASHES

Wearing demi lashes should never be stressful. To remove, gently peel from the outer corner inward. Pull any leftover adhesive off the band with your fingers or tweezers. Place them back in the tray. A pair of demi lashes can last up to 15 wears if you keep them clean. That means you can own two pairs and rotate them for a month of effortless lift.

FAQ

Can I wear demi lashes with mascara?

Yes, but apply mascara to your natural lashes first, then place the demi lash over it. That way you don’t clump the lash.

How long do demi lashes last?

A single demi lash can last all day — and you won’t feel them. Reuse them up to 15 times if you clean them gently.

Do demi lashes damage my natural lashes?

No, not when applied correctly to natural lashes with a thin band. The key is removing them gently and never sleeping in them.
